Security Standards for Locks and Their Importance in Home Protection

Table of Contents

The security of our homes begins with reliable locks that adhere to current safety standards. In this article, we will explore essential standards for locks, highlighting the importance of installing locks that comply with these standards to ensure optimal protection for your home.

Lock Security Standards

  1. A2P Certification
    1. The A2P certification, awarded by the National Center for Prevention and Protection (CNPP), is a French reference standard for assessing the resistance of locks against burglary attempts. A2P-certified locks are classified into three categories (1 to 3 stars), based on their resistance level. The higher the number of stars, the more secure the lock is considered.
  2. NF Standard
    1. The NF (Norme Française) standard is a certification of compliance with French and European standards. Locks bearing the NF label have been tested to ensure their strength and durability. This certification provides additional assurance regarding the product’s quality.
  3. EN 1627 Standard
    1. At the European level, the EN 1627 standard defines the resistance levels of doors, windows, and locks to burglary attempts. Locks compliant with this standard have undergone rigorous tests to assess their resistance to physical attacks.

The Importance of Installing Locks Compliant with Standards

  1. Resistance to Burglary Attempts
    1. Security standards ensure that locks have been tested and meet specific resistance criteria. Installing locks compliant with standards provides increased resistance to burglary attempts, thus deterring intruders.
  2. Long-term Reliability
    1. Locks compliant with standards are designed to offer long-term reliability. Proper installation ensures that the lock functions effectively for many years, reducing the risk of malfunctions.
  3. Home Insurance
    1. Some insurers require locks compliant with standards as a condition for insuring your home. By installing certified locks, you may often qualify for discounts on your insurance premiums.
